Problem 1: Theoretical assignment 1. Use Newton's method to solve x + e* = 0 with an accuracy of 3 decimal places. Please show the specific results at each iterative steps until it converges. (Initial guess Xo = -1). 2. Use Secant method to solve x + em = 0 with an accuracy of 3 decimal places. Please show the specific results at each iterative steps until it converges. (Initial guess Xo = -1, x1 = -1.1). 3. Plot absolute value of residual V.S. iterative steps. Note: 1. This is a theoretical assignment, you need to solve it by hand. You can use computer to evaluate exponent function if necessary, but you do not need to program everything. 2. Rough definition of converged solution: the results with 3 decimal places doesn't change, and both methods can get converged results within 10 steps in this case. 3. The solution of Problem 1 should include: (a) Question 1: write down each iterative step of Newton's method, show the specific evaluation to get Ik. Show Ik and the associated residual at each step. (Points: 20) (b) Question 2: write down each iterative step of Secant method, show the specific evaluation to get Xk. Show Ik and the associated residual at each step. (Points: 20) (c) Question 3: only output one figure including both secant and New- ton's methods. 3 axis: iterative steps; y axis: absolute value of residual at each step (You have got these values from Questions 1 and 2.)
